Ivy


Ivy was adopted 9 years ago by her “mom,” a self-employed woman living in La Mesa. Last week, Ivy suddenly got very sick. She was vomiting, wouldn’t eat or drink water, and was extremely lethargic. After taking her to the veterinarian, it was determined that Ivy had a foreign body obstruction – she swallowed an object that needed to be surgically removed.  The urgent costs were not something Ivy’s mom could fully afford and it needed to be done ASAP, so she reached out to FACE. With help from our donors and supporters, we were able to quickly approve her application and get Ivy the surgery she needed to pull through. As it turns out, she swallowed a peach pit! Her owner had no idea, as Ivy doesn’t usually get into things, but she is so grateful FACE was there at her time in need.
